Man Seriously Injured In Woodbury 3-Car Wreck: Report
A man was seriously injured in a Route 6 crash Wednesday afternoon.

WOODBURY, CT — A three-car crash on Route 6 on Wednesday afternoon left a man seriously injured, The Danbury News-Times reported. A 2018 Chevrolet Bolt was traveling north on Route 6 when it crossed into the southbound lane and struck a 2018 Jeep Grand Cherokee.
The Jeep then spun and struck a 2012 Honda CR-V.
A 78-year-old Bethlehem man was transported to Waterbury Hospital with serious injuries, according to The Danbury News-Times.

A 34-year-old Woodbury woman suffered minor injuries, and a 77-year-old Southbury woman was not injured.
